About the Book

Serpents and Ladders is a memoir about hardships, headaches, and heartaches encountered by the author during her lifetime. It is a story everyone should read since we often face serpents at one point or another. The author realized that she had made some poor decisions by not searching for the plans God had for her. Her destiny was not in her hands. As she sought guidance, the Almighty set ladders to crush the serpents. The author takes us from a shattered world to a victorious one.


About the Author

Dora Taylor is a French American who lives in Montgomery, Texas. She started travelling at the age of 5. Her father was a physician for the French community of sugar companies located along the Nile River in Egypt. When her father decided to join the RAMC (Royal Army Medical Corps) with the allied forces, the family moved to Zeitoun, near Cairo.
After WWII, she spent her teenage years in Libya. Dora lived in 12 countries and visited 21 others.
Dora holds English Proficiency certificates from the University of Michigan, Ann Arbor, USA and the University of Cambridge, England. Teaching became a real vocation in her life. She taught English and French to teens and adults at all levels, in Europe, Africa, Asia, South and North America.
Dora is the founder and honorary president of the American Women’s Group of Languedoc-Roussillon, in Montpellier, France since 1986. The association has proven beneficial to its members and the local community. It has been successful in raising funds for children with cancer, battered woman and charity.
Dora has also initiated an English service with the help of Pastor Van Dyk at the Evangelical Reformed church in Montpellier.
Today, Dora attends April Sound Church in Montgomery, Texas and serves under the leadership of Pastor Dowen Johnson. Dora’s lifelong motto is “To obey and trust in God at all times is the key to victory”.
